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96579525 958332024 445 637897826
634387 656
634387 656
9949 6479771 77925
All about undefined
Interested in learning more?
634387 656
9949 6479771 77925
See more
505 389 349
60746 84686 46032464 0065539
See more
2381765 430 44034767
64072 37465043326 858 34141 3422
See more